Question 213158: Given the function f is defined by f(x)= ax^2 + bx + c Given that f(0) = 6, f(-1)= 15, and f(1) = 1, find the values of a, b, and c.

f(x)=ax^2+bx+c
for x=0
f(0)=c as given f(0)=6 so c=6
for x=-1
f(-1)=a-b+6 as given f(-1)=15 so a-b+6=15; a-b=9 _____e
for x=1
f(1)=a+b+6 as given f(1)=1 so a+b+6=1; a+b=-5 _____f
by adding eq e & f we have a=2
and put value of 'a' in eq f we have b=-7 so we have
a=2;b=-7;c=6
